Transaction 75a61d685a08ff860662f1a4b8fcc6c581d566aec642025c06615f5e48447567
1 Input
1 Output
-
75a61d685a08ff860662f1a4b8fcc6c581d566aec642025c06615f5e48447567:0
- value
- 778500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fcb63fff6c8a65158fec7772b3e2813f04e024b O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Gv2z1bv9zM7rgXiagebFNYyrzVoXnYUZ